FEDERAL EMERGENCY MANAGEMENT AGENCY

Agency Information Collection Activities: Proposed Collection; Comment Request

ACTION: Notice and request for comments.

SUMMARY: The Federal Emergency Management Agency invites the general public and other Federal agencies to comment on a proposed continuing information collection which has been submitted to the Office of Management and Budget for review and clearance. In accordance with the Paperwork Reduction Act of 1995 (44 U.S.C. 3506(c)(2)(A)), this notice seeks comments concerning collection of State Administrative Plans. These plans provide the basis for awards of Federal financial contributions to the States for necessary and essential State and local emergency preparedness personnel and administrative expenses.

SUPPLEMENTARY INFORMATION: This information collection is required by the Robert T. Stafford Disaster Relief and Emergency Assistance Act, as amended, 42 U.S.C. 5121 et seq., Section 613. FEMA manages the requirement in accordance with 44 CFR 13.11, FEMA's implementation of the Uniform Administrative Requirements for Grants and Cooperative Agreements to State and Local Governments. Additional background information may be found in 44 CFR 302.2(u) and 44 CFR 302.3(a). The Federal contributions for State and local emergency preparedness personnel and administrative expenses to which this requirement is related are now delivered through FEMA's Emergency Management--State and Local Assistance program, Catalog of Federal Domestic Assistance Number 83.534.

Collection of Information

Title: State Administrative Plan.

Type of Information Collection: Extension of a currently approved collection.

OMB Number: 3067-0138.

Abstract: The State Administrative Plan is a formal description of the participating State's emergency preparedness program and related State and local laws, executive directives, rules, plans, and procedures. It documents and certifies the State's compliance with requirements of the authorizing statute. The plan is a one-time submission with annual updates to keep it current. Plans and updates are submitted to the FEMA Regional Offices along with the annual applications for assistance under emergency management programs. FEMA uses the information to determine whether a State legally qualifies for Federal contributions for State and local emergency preparedness personnel and administrative expenses.

Affected Public: State and Local or Tribal Governments.

Estimated Total Annual Burden Hours: 1,120.
